9 Spotlight on Vietnam Vietnam Ministry of Planning and Investment has had success with PPPs in non-health sectors: transport, energy, agriculture, science. In the health sector, PPPs are being used but are sporadic and not necessarily coordinated to greatest needs and government vision: Many related to joint ventures for equipment High interest in quick win areas large hospitals in urban centers: not always the biggest need Untapped potential of private sector partners in: 1. Integrated healthcare networks 2. Chronic disease partnerships / Primary care 3. IT/eHealth 4. Management skills to operate effective providers
